Brothersis Nico Slate's poignant memoir about Peter Slate, akaXL, aBlack rapper and screenwriter whose life was tragically cut short. Nico and Peter shared the same White American mother but had different fathers. Nico's was White; Peter's was Black. Growing up in California in the 1980s and 1990s, Nico often forgot about their racial differences until one night in March 1994 when Peter was attacked by a White man in a nightclub in Los Angeles. Nico began writingBrotherswith the hope that investigating the attack would bring him closer to Peter. He could not understand that night, however, without grappling with the many ways race had long separated him from his brother. This is a memoir of loss-the loss of a life and the loss at the heart of our racial divide-but it is also a memoir of love.The love between Nico and Peter permeates every page ofBrothers.This achingly beautiful memoir presents one family's resilience on the fault lines of race in contemporary America.
